Honoré Daumier was a French artist known primarily for his caricatures, illustrations, and sculptures. He was born in 1808 and stood out as a prominent engraver and sculptor of his time. His work focused on political and social satire, depicting scenes of everyday life and public figures with a characteristic and humorous style. His work has had a significant impact on art and is considered one of the masters of modern caricature.
